A Rare Glimpse into Marine Life

In an unprecedented event, scientists were fortunate enough to document the birthing process of a sperm whale, showcasing not just the mother but also a remarkable array of helpers. This event, filmed off the coast of the Caribbean, illustrates that the nurturing instinct extends beyond mere survival, highlighting a complex social structure within these marine mammals.

The footage captures a mother sperm whale giving birth, surrounded by a supportive pod of females. These companions, likely her relatives, played a crucial role in ensuring the safety and well-being of both the mother and the newborn calf. As the birth unfolded, the pod exhibited behaviours that suggested they were not merely passive observers but active participants in the birthing process, providing protection and encouragement.

Evidence of Cooperative Breeding

This event adds to a growing body of evidence suggesting that many species, including humans, are not alone in seeking assistance during childbirth. The idea of cooperative breeding, where individuals assist in the care of young beyond their own offspring, is increasingly recognised among various animal species.

Sperm whales are known for their highly social nature, living in matriarchal groups where females often remain with their maternal pods for life. This latest observation reinforces the notion that social bonds play an essential role in the birthing process, raising questions about the evolutionary advantages of such cooperative behaviours.
